53-56 Find \(y'\) and \(y''\).
53. \(y = {\bf{cos}}\left( {{\bf{sin}}\,{\bf{3}}\theta } \right)\)
Short Answer
The value of \(y'\) is \( - 3\cos 3\theta \sin \left( {\sin 3\theta } \right)\).
The value of \(y''\) is \( - 9{\cos ^2}3\theta \cos \left( {\sin 3\theta } \right) + 9\sin 3\theta \sin \left( {\sin 3\theta } \right)\).
